Last night, while driving the bus (its what I do for a living), I saw the most stunning example of poor roadsense that Id ever seen. At the point where Yates St. splits off of Fort St. I (barely) saw a bicycle fly through a crosswalk without turning to look at traffic (like 18,000lb buses quickly approching). Said bicycle had no rear light to make it visible to traffic approaching from behind the cyclist. The young woman on this bicycle proceeded to continue down Yates in the lefthand lane of the one way street (which has a bicycle lane on the righthand side.), texting continuously and looking up once or twice a block. As I was pulling in and out of stops I was basically driving along the opposite side of the street, stunned and aghast at her thoughtlessness from Harrison to Blanshard. 1.4km and Im not sure how long she had been doing it before that or how long she did it for (I was stopped at Blanshard for a bit longer to let an older gentleman with a walker off.) Tonight she rode my bus and stuck her bike on the bike rack.
